Event details

Portland Rose Festival Opening Night and Fireworks is your high energy start to Oregon’s best known civic celebration, set at Tom McCall Waterfront Park along the Willamette River in downtown Portland. The focus is CityFair, a seasonal carnival of rides, games, and food vendors, with the Ferris wheel and midway lights turning the waterfront into a prime photo stop against the skyline. You will see families, couples, and groups settling in with fair classics and live music as the three week festival begins.

CityFair gates open at 5:00 PM on Friday, May 22, 2026, and crowds build quickly for the holiday weekend. Plan to arrive by 6:00 PM if you want time to explore, eat, and choose your spot without rushing. Food and drink options change year to year, but you can typically count on elephant ears, corn dogs, and a solid lineup of local beer plus regional snacks.

The night ends with a large fireworks show set to a custom soundtrack, scheduled for 9:50 PM. For the strongest audio and a direct view, we recommend watching from inside the CityFair grounds near the river wall. If you prefer to skip the ticketed area, you can still get excellent views from the Eastbank Esplanade or the Hawthorne Bridge.

Expect a $5 CityFair entry fee for most attendees, with children 6 and under and active military members with ID often admitted free. Use MAX Light Rail since street parking is limited and lots fill early, and bring a light water resistant jacket because late May weather can change fast. Bags are allowed but searched at the gate, and inside the fenced area you cannot bring outside seating, glass, or pets. The event runs rain or shine, though heavy rain can briefly delay fireworks, and if the park hits capacity, entry may pause, so earlier is better.
